The temperature and concentration dependences of electric resistivity of nickel-chromium alloys in liquid state have been studied. Experimental data shows non-linear concentration dependence of ρ isotherms of alloys. The wavy-type character of the isotherms of nickel-chromium melts resistance has been qualitatively explained with the theory of percolation and model of microunhomogeneity structure of melts.
